.NET 5, Blazor και πολλά άλλα το 2021!

.NET 5, Blazor και πολλά άλλα το 2021!

Januar 23, 2023 0 Von admin

Εκσυγχρονίζω: Λόγω νέων προσωπικών υποχρεώσεων και περισσότερων εργασιακών υποχρεώσεων το 2021, δεν μπόρεσα να σημειώσω μεγάλη πρόοδο με την εβδομαδιαία μου σειρά C# AZ στο dev.to/shahedc.
Προς το παρόν, θα επικεντρωθώ σε κάποιο νέο περιεχόμενο για το κανονικό μου ιστολόγιο (αυτό το ιστολόγιο, WakeUpAndCode.com) και ελπίζω να ξαναεπισκεφτώ τη σειρά AZ με το .NET 6.

Αρχική ανάρτηση:

Δημοσίευσα την πρώτη μου σειρά ASP .NET Core AZ στο WakeUpAndCode.com το 2019, από τον Ιανουάριο έως τον Ιούνιο του 2019. Ακολούθησα αυτό με μια νέα σειρά AZ το 2020, αντικατοπτρίζοντας ταυτόχρονα τις αναρτήσεις και στο dev.to.

Στο εξής, η επόμενη σειρά AZ μου θα καλύπτει 26 θέματα που καλύπτουν διάφορες λειτουργίες γλώσσας C#. Η σειρά C# AZ θα εμφανίζεται αποκλειστικά στον ιστότοπό μου dev.to στο .NET org:

Προεπισκόπηση της σειράς C# A έως Z σε DEV

Εν τω μεταξύ, αυτός ο ιστότοπος (WakeUpAndCode.com) θα συνεχίσει να διαθέτει νέο περιεχόμενο ASP .NET Core που βασίζεται σε .NET 5, Blazor και άλλα! Για να λάβετε μια ελάχιστη κορύφωση του τι πρόκειται να ακολουθήσει, ρίξτε μια ματιά στην εμφάνισή μου ως φιλοξενούμενος στο .NET Docs Show (ζωντανή μετάδοση στις 7 Δεκεμβρίου 2020). Μπορείτε να πηδήσετε μπροστά στο 58:05 στο βίντεο για την κλεφτή ματιά:

Το παραπάνω βίντεο πειράζει την επερχόμενη κινηματογραφική μου εφαρμογή οπτικοποίησης, η οποία θα επιτρέψει στον τελικό χρήστη να συνδέσει τις κουκκίδες μέσα σε ένα κινηματογραφικό σύμπαν, π.χ. στο Marvel Cinematic Universe. Ο πηγαίος κώδικας θα επιτρέψει σε κάθε προγραμματιστή .NET να μάθει περισσότερα για τα C# και .NET 5, ASP .NET Core, Entity Framework, Azure App Service, Bot Framework, Azure Functions και πολλά άλλα!

Διάγραμμα υψηλού επιπέδου κινηματογραφικού οπτικοποιητή

Ο στόχος της εφαρμογής Ιστού είναι να κάνει χρήση και των 3 στυλ έργων που είναι διαθέσιμα στο ASP .NET Core:

  • MVC (Ελεγκτής προβολής μοντέλου)
  • Σελίδες ξυραφιού
  • Blazor
Αρχιτεκτονική web ASP .NET Core

Οι προγραμματιστές ρωτούν συχνά την κοινότητα προγραμματιστών (και τη Microsoft) εάν προτιμάται ένας συγκεκριμένος τύπος έργου web έναντι του άλλου. Η περσινή σειρά ιστολογίων βασίστηκε στην εφαρμογή Ιστού NetLearner αντιγράφοντας την ίδια λειτουργικότητα και στους τρεις τύπους έργων. Φέτος, η εφαρμογή cinematic visualizer θα επιχειρήσει να χρησιμοποιήσει κάθε τύπο έργου με κάτι συγκεκριμένο.

  • MVC για εισαγωγή δεδομένων
  • Σελίδες ξυραφιού για τον ιστότοπο της Πύλης
  • Blazor για την εξαιρετικά διαδραστική μερίδα

Οι παραπάνω επιλογές δεν είναι απαραίτητα καθοριστικές για τον τύπο των εφαρμογών ιστού που θα επιδείξουν. Ωστόσο, θα πρέπει να παρέχουν ένα σημείο εκκίνησης κατά την ανάπτυξη εφαρμογών web ASP .NET Core.